Output 64e46a9f8059fb072d0cfa1115dd7bb01bd5c478b77b80daa5b9bbbb301d9ab9:1

value
639063008
script pubkey
OP_0 OP_PUSHBYTES_20 dea11193e4518cd4112923b3c3d66fb9f23ad4ea
address
bc1qm6s3ryly2xxdgyffyweu84n0h8er44827v2fhf
transaction
64e46a9f8059fb072d0cfa1115dd7bb01bd5c478b77b80daa5b9bbbb301d9ab9
confirmations
424750
spent
true